Last Week

  • US inflation soars to 7% for the first time since 1982.
  • France to ease Covid border controls with UK as Omicron infections approach peak.
  • Chinese tech stocks jumped Wednesday, continuing a rollercoaster start to the year as traders seek to anticipate the direction of global monetary policy.
  • Eurozone house prices rise at fastest rate on record. Between June and September last year, eurozone house prices rose by an annual rate of 8.8%, according to official Eurostat data.
  • On Friday official data showed that Britain’s economy grew strongly in November to finally surpass its size just before the country went into its first COVID-19 lockdown.
